1 dead, 7 injured after car ran red light that caused crash, Oregon officials say

PORTLAND, Ore. (KOIN) – On Monday, a car crash in Clackamas County took the life of one person and injured seven more. Investigators said that a gray Kia Telluride, operated by Nathan Dale Ellis, 50, of Hubbard, was traveling southbound on Highway 99E near Canby when it failed to stop at the stoplight at South Barlow Road. The vehicle struck a tan Chevrolet Silverado, operated by Jesus David Barajas Diaz, 47, of Canby on the driver's side. Kia passenger, Sharon Lyn Prentice, 71, of Hubbard, was pronounced dead at the scene. Ellis was transported to a local hospital with minor injuries. Another passenger in the Kia Crystal Dawn Grumbo, 47, of Aumsville, and three juvenile passengers were transported to a local hospital with minor injuries. Diaz and passenger Juan Alonso Ocegueda Lopez, 45, were both transported to a local hospital with minor injuries.
